Finding a great corned beef sandwich can be a challenge,especially outside of seasonal offerings . While many restaurants serve standard deli meats like ham and turkey,corned beef often takes a back seat. However, several chain restaurants have made it staple on their menus, providing options for fans of this savory delight.
Primo Hoagies, originally a Philadelphia-based chain,has expanded its reach across nine states along the East Coast. Known for its high-quality meats and distinctive sesame-seeded bread,the restaurant features the corned beef Schwartzie as a permanent menu item. This sandwich includes sliced-to-order corned beef, coleslaw,Swiss cheese,and Russian dressing, offering a unique twist on the classic Reuben. The use of coleslaw instead of sauerkraut and the signature seeded bun set this sandwich apart,making it popular choice among customers.
Arby's has carved out a niche for itself with its corned beef Reuben, which ranks among the chain's best offerings. Known for its generous portions of well-textured corned beef,the sandwich is layered between thick slices of marbled rye bread. combination of tangy sauerkraut,Swiss cheese, and creamy Thousand Island dressing enhances the flavor profile, making it a standout item on Arby's menu. Customers frequently praise its impressive presentation,a rarity in the fast-food sector.
McAlister's Deli is another chain that excels in delivering quality corned beef sandwiches. With nearly 600 locations across 31 states,it offers two notable options: the traditional Reuben and the New Yorker. The Reuben features Swiss cheese, sauerkraut,and Thousand Island dressing on marbled rye,while New Yorker combines corned beef with pastrami and spicy brown mustard,also on marbled rye. Both sandwiches are crafted with premium ingredients,ensuring satisfying experience for diners.
Bennigan's has made a comeback after facing bankruptcy in 2008, with 25 locations reopening worldwide, including 10 in the U.S. The chain's classic Reuben is a permanent menu item, appealing to those who appreciate well-made sandwich. Although Bennigan's is often associated with its Monte Cristo, the Reuben stands out for its hearty quality and authentic corned beef,making it a worthy choice for fans of this traditional dish.
Culver's may be best known for its ButterBurgers, but it also offers a grilled Reuben melt that surprises customers with its quality. sandwich features buttered and grilled rye bread, filled with corned beef and other traditional toppings . This option showcases Culver's commitment to providing a diverse menu that goes beyond typical fast-casual offerings .
